Pantoro Gold's FY2026 gold output fell below expectations due to contractor and labour shortages, prompting a strategic operational review. The company targets 90,000 to 105,000 ounces in FY2027 with a stabilisation-first approach and significant investments in new ore sources and infrastructure.

Xingye Gold has increased its takeover bid for Far East Gold to $0.15 per share, conditional on securing majority ownership by 21 July 2026, and extended the offer period to 29 July. The improved price offers a significant premium amid ongoing project and financial risks at Far East Gold.

Renascor Resources' cost study estimates its hydrofluoric acid-free purification method can produce battery-grade graphite at about US$459 per tonne, positioning it as a competitive ex-China alternative to conventional HF-based processes.

Meteoric Resources has surged its Measured Resources by 246% to 128 million tonnes at its Caldeira Rare Earth Element Project in Brazil, significantly de-risking the upcoming Definitive Feasibility Study and underpinning future development plans.
